I would like to find anyone connected with my father's family. My Grandfather Daniel Vail, born 1872, Greenwich, had a pub in West Norwood, but he died in 1933 before I was born. He had brothers and my Dad's cousins scattered to Canada and Australia. I have vague memories of meeting some of those relatives as a child. The family had arrived in London from Huntingdonshire. I was told that Vail is a contraction of MacPhail, and that the family originally came from Inverary, moving to England after the 1745 rebellion.
